Blend is a diverse team of problem solvers who believe that the world’s financial resources should be more accessible. Our cloud banking platform is used by Wells Fargo, U.S. Bank, and over 330 other financial services firms to acquire more customers, increase productivity, and deliver end-to-end digital experiences. Our software enables our customers to process an average of more than $5 billion in loans per day, making it possible for consumers to reach their financial goals faster and lead better lives. Blend is hiring an exceptional Client Sales Executive responsible for retaining, expanding, and deepening relationships with existing Independent Mortgage Bank (IMB) customers by transforming the technology that powers their consumer and residential lending operations.
In this role, you will serve as a trusted strategic partner to a portfolio of IMB customers, developing a deep understanding of their origination models, operational workflows, regulatory considerations, and growth strategies. You will focus on renewals, expansion, platform adoption, and the successful rollout of new features across Blend Mortgage - driving long-term customer value and revenue growth within the IMB segment.
How You’ll Contribute:
- Own and manage the post-sale customer lifecycle for a portfolio of Independent Mortgage Bank customers, with responsibility for renewals, expansions, and long-term account growth.
- Lead the renewal process for IMB accounts, coordinating internal stakeholders to ensure successful, timely renewals aligned to customer business cycles.
- Build and deepen executive-level relationships across IMB leadership, including Operations, Technology, Digital, and Lending executives.
- Act as a trusted advisor by bringing forward strategic recommendations that align Blend’s platform with IMB priorities such as pull-through, borrower experience, operational efficiency, and scalability.
- Develop and execute account strategies to increase adoption and expansion across Blend’s product suite, including Home Buying Journey and consumer engagement offerings.
- Identify, qualify, and close upsell and cross-sell opportunities within existing IMB accounts by aligning new product capabilities to evolving business needs.
- Partner closely with Customer Success, Implementation, Product, Marketing, and Support teams to drive successful outcomes across complex IMB environments.
- Contribute to account-specific marketing, adoption, and usage strategies that support lender growth and maximize platform value.
- Help define and manage customer project plans, including implementation timelines, resourcing requirements, risk mitigation, and budget considerations.
- Maintain a strong understanding of mortgage market trends, regulatory dynamics, and competitive pressures impacting Independent Mortgage Banks.
